OpenMV is a brand that offers small, affordable, and expandable machine vision modules. Started by Ibrahim in 2013, the OpenMV project began as a personal endeavor in search of a better serial camera module. Over time, it grew from Ibrahim's blog to a Hackaday project, then to a successful Kickstarter campaign, and now stands as a fully established brand.
In 2015, Kaizhi Wong, with his experience in product placement, joined the team to help turn the OpenMV project into a reality. Together, Ibrahim and Kaizhi run the OpenMV project, ensuring its success and growth. OpenMV specializes in creating products such as cameras, shields, lenses, and swag, designed to cater to various machine vision needs.
Their website provides users with a plethora of resources including documentation, tutorials, a library, and a language forum.
